Husyckie Skały
Husyckie Skały is a climbing site in Gmina Mysłakowice, Jelenia Góra County, Lower Silesian Voivodeship. Husyckie Skały is situated nearby to the mountain saddle Przełączka, as well as near the ruins Zamek Sokolec.Places of Interest Nearby
